OnePack Plan Pet Insurance Launches in Canada Enabling Employers to Bring Peace of Mind to Canadian Pet Parents
Despite Canadian pet ownership being on the rise with 58 percent of households owning a dog or cat, just 2 percent of workplaces offer pet insurance as an employee benefit. OnePack Plan is proud to announce its launch into the Canadian market providing companies, group benefits providers and benefits consultants the option to include pet insurance as a benefit for pet-parent employees. Available across all of Canada in both English and French Canadian, OnePack Plan provides employers the option to offer payroll-deductible pet insurance for cats and dogs with a flat group rate, helping to make veterinary costs more manageable during a time when many Canadians are worried about unexpected vet bills.

An Increasing Desire for Employer-Offered Pet Insurance
OnePack Plan’s research found with Canadian pet ownership increasing, 50 percent of Canadian pet parents express interest in employer-offered pet insurance1, demonstrating a large demand for this offering across the country. OnePack Plan bridges this gap, providing a highly requested employee benefit that attracts and retains talent while also supporting pet parents in providing the best care for their furry family members.
Financial strain over unexpected veterinary costs is common among Canadians. The same study conducted by OnePack Plan found 42 percent of Canadian pet parents make financial sacrifices for pet care, with 40 percent saying they have missed work due to their pet’s health1.
OnePack Plan can help provide relief and peace of mind with comprehensive coverage and affordable premiums, including optional add-ons for wellness and preventative care. The plan features no breed restrictions and can offer coverage for pre-existing conditions after 365 days of continuous coverage3.
